Beschreibung


Journey through the desolated kingdom of Penumbra and discover the hidden secrets of this long-forgotten land. Explore mystical temples, where you’ll need to master the art of movement to survive increasingly difficult 3D platforming challenges. During your adventure you’ll slash your way through daunting adversaries, encounter survivors and take on strange quests to collect valuable items.



Hardcore Platforming

Leap through deadly traps and master movement to navigate gradually demanding platforming challenges.

Lost in the Void

Far from Penumbra, there is a lost land called The Void. Find Void entrances throughout the world to uncover abstract platforming challenges that require great mastery to gather the valuable rewards hidden inside.

Slash Your Way Through Great Adversaries

Encounter dangerous enemies with distinct fighting styles and partake in intense combat-platforming boss fights.

A Haunting World

Travel through the perished world of Penumbra to explore unique areas filled with diverse enemies, sharp 3D platforming challenges, quests, collectibles and more.

Encounter Peculiar Survivors

A long time has passed since Penumbra fell into darkness, but those that survived the kingdom’s fall will aid your journey to unlock valuable rewards.

Collectibles

Once a rich and lush kingdom, Penumbra is filled with many collectibles and items to discover, loot, collect, sell, trade and purchase.

Upgrades

No great warrior can battle the dangers lurking in Penumbra without the proper equipment. Upgrade your swords, collect valuable amulets and unlock new abilities to transform into a fierce fighter.

Neat platformer

If you like jumping and dashing through levels and don't mind retrying tough challenges a few times, this might be the game for you: the progression of your movement abilities is satisfying, falling off the level isn't too punishing, you can still get in a lot of places earlier than you probably should if you're clever and persistent, the void levels (the real challenges the game has to offer) aren't too demanding outside a handful of optional late-game ones (and the whole post-game Void of Sorrows stuff, but that's to be expected), and the camera does a great job for the most part (again, outside of the post-game stuff). If you're here because of the "Action" and "Adventure" tags on the store page or expected a Soulslike, this isn't the game for you: combat, story, quests, inventory, all that stuff is there but it's nothing special. With that said, even if you like the platforming I would suggest stopping after the main story ends: the post-game void levels love to combine insta-kill surfaces, bad camera angles, tight timings, and scarce checkpoints, there's a couple of them with cool ideas but they're not worth slogging through the rest.

Addictive Zelda-Like That Delivers

Notice: I completed the game on the Switch version and was incredibly addicted to completing the game once I got past the intro areas and became proficient. Highly recommend this title to anyone that loves action/adventure/puzzle/platformer. Great atmosphere. Blue Fire is an amazing action-adventure game that presents a polished package similar to Zelda titles before Breath of the Wild. The level design is tight and intentional. The story unfolds in sections, with each potion of the world becoming more accessible as you gain tools and skills (or you get really good at what you have and get somewhere early). Each new item or skill is added as you start to become proficient with the previous ones, and the gameplay becomes ever more addictive with each newly mastered technique. I couldn't put this game down. Remember how you solve one puzzle, because there is a good chance it was there to teach out how to do a portion of the next one. The controls are precise and responsive. Each death or failure is your own fault. I have played a lot of action-adventure games that can't get the feel right, but luckily in Blue Fire the camera moves as it should and your character immediately response to input. Since the game has platforming that requires precise inputs, this is very important. Thankfully the controls are implemented well. I also really enjoyed the atmosphere. Take a look at videos and screenshots and know that the style is consistent throughout the entire experience. Whether in sewers, bogs, cathedrals, walkways or castle balconies, the visuals have a unified vision that makes the world feel "real". I did get lost once, but this game rewards you for exploring, so I kept at it until I found myself back on track. It's a mostly linear experience that becomes more open as you unlock or find ways into other areas. Didn't get lost to the point where a walkthrough was needed, so it wasn't a frustrating lost. Nearly perfect experience. Highly recommended.

3D Platformer first and foremost.

As the title suggests, this is NOT a windwaker clone despite looking like it and sharing a bunch of zelda-esque features. You can feel the small team and low budget, but they stretched it as much as they could into a fully featured singleplayer experience. I don't play much 3d platformers (last one i played was Supermario Sunshine when it came out) but really enjoyed the physics. I see some complaints about the ever so slight "slipperyness" of the walking, but if you've ever played an oldschool doom game I really don't see the issue. I personally enjoy working with a bit of momentum, but I would hardly describe the movement as momentum based. Combat felt like a bit of an afterthought, and very very easy on normal. But it wasn't a distraction either. Sidequests where you look for people in the (quite small) metroidvaniaesque world I enjoyed too. But you don't have a map wich might confuse some less orientation prone players. Managing money feels a bit odd at times. It respawns in crates around the world you can break and you can sell some gems to get it. You can find an unlockable skill that doubles the money you get wich carried me at almost max cash throughout the game until I found another bigger wallet. The look of the game is kind of hit or miss to me. I prefer windwaker wich it is based on but can see some people really getting into it. Music wise, atleast the main "city hub" that was very memorable to me and very atmospheric. Can't really comment on the rest of it as I don't remember it. But that one theme of stoneheart city and the forest temple/undead burg inspired environment was incredibly cozy. Is it a must play? Not really, but if you look for a platformer with some exploration i'd check it out. The dlc I enjoyed too to get the movement really out of my system. I tried demon turf after finishing the main game and eventually dropped that to do all the extra more challenging bonus levels as I enjoyed those much much more in terms of movement.

This game isn't fun

This game relies heavilyon 3d platforming and it's easy to overshoot platforms and fall into a pit. Doing so sets you back to a predetermined location in the room, which can be far away from where you fell. This is particularly bad in the Voids, where a fall sets you back to the beginning of the challenge. I'm not sure why the developer thought that playing more of a level should be the punishment for falling. As with the platforming, the combat is similarly rough. Enemies don't seem to react much to being hit and neither does the player character, so I regularly found myself taking damage without realising. The mechanics seems to function well though. It feels like someone played Hollow Knight and decided that they'd make a 3d version of it without quite understanding why Hollow Knight was good. It's not a bad game, but it lacks the character and polish that makes games like Hollow Knight and Death's Door good and I wouldn't recommend it.
